FSBUS Servo
 
Hello

I have a littel problem with the FSBUS Servo.

The instrumet i have connectet to the servo-board, is always make small movents to both side. it seems that it get some signal every time the FSBUS2 router is geting information from the FS2002. If i stop the FS2002 the instrument is standing still.

Have anybody have the same problem, and can it be doing someting to avoid the problem.

regards

Finn
Denmark

DeLaPlata 01.08.2003 11:02

shielded cables
 
Seems to be a noisy cable, probably unshielded ?
It works like an antenna, if it's not shielded.
It has to be grounded at one side (end) of the cable.
May be also that a nearby cable transmits by
capacitive coupling noise to your "hot" cable.
Do not lay cables side by side !!!
This looks nice, but supports the effect of capacitive coupling.
Is the servo proper balanced? too high amplification looks also like noisy inputs !
